Top-Rated Schools and Education

One of the most compelling reasons families move to Sammamish is its exceptional public school system. The city is served by two of the best districts in the state:

  • Lake Washington School District

  • Issaquah School District

Schools such as Eastlake High School and Skyline High School consistently earn high marks for academics, safety, and extracurricular excellence. These institutions prepare students for top universities and future careers, making Sammamish a haven for families prioritizing education.

🏞 Outdoor Activities and Parks

Sammamish is a dream location for nature lovers and outdoor adventurers. With parks, lakes, and trail systems right outside your door, there’s always something to explore. Popular recreational areas include:

  • Pine Lake Park – A community favorite with a swimming beach, playground, dock, and space for summer concerts.

  • Beaver Lake Park – Home to walking trails, fishing spots, and seasonal community events.

  • Soaring Eagle Regional Park – A local gem for hiking, biking, and wildlife viewing.

Whether it’s a weekend hike or an evening picnic, Sammamish offers easy access to the outdoor lifestyle that defines the Pacific Northwest.

💼 Commute-Friendly with Easy Access to Tech Hubs

Living in Sammamish means enjoying the peace of suburbia without sacrificing your career goals. The city is within a 20–30 minute drive to Redmond, Bellevue, and other major employment hubs, including the headquarters of Microsoft, Amazon, and Google. For remote workers, the city’s high-speed internet and home-office–friendly housing make it an excellent base.

🎉 A Close-Knit Community with Year-Round Events

Sammamish shines with its focus on community engagement and family-friendly activities. Signature events include:

  • Sammamish Farmers Market – Held every Wednesday from May through September and sponsored by the Sammamish Chamber of Commerce (@SammamishChamber, on Instagram: @sammamishchamber), one of the most active chambers in the region. The market draws hundreds of residents each week for fresh produce, local goods, and a welcoming atmosphere.

  • Fourth on the Plateau – An epic Independence Day celebration sponsored by the City of Sammamish, featuring fireworks, food trucks, and live entertainment.

  • Concerts in the Park – Sponsored by the city and held at Pine Lake Park, these summer evenings are filled with music, food, and family-friendly fun.

These events foster a strong sense of belonging and make it easy to meet new friends and neighbors.

🏘 Best Sammamish Neighborhoods to Explore

Each Sammamish neighborhood offers its own unique vibe. Here are a few local favorites:

  • Sahalee – A gated golf community known for security, serenity, and tree-lined streets.

  • Klahanie – Family-friendly with parks, trails, and community pools.

  • Trossachs – Known for luxury homes, manicured landscaping, and proximity to top schools.

  • Renaissance Ridge – Nestled in the heart of the Sammamish Plateau, this upscale neighborhood is highly sought after for its exceptional walkability to key amenities. Residents enjoy easy strolls to the Sammamish Commons (home to the Library and City Hall), Met Market for groceries, and highly-rated Issaquah School District schools like Discovery Elementary, Pine Lake Middle, and Skyline High School. Many homes in Renaissance Ridge also back to lush greenbelts, offering privacy and a serene connection to nature. The neighborhood also features its own community parks and playgrounds.
